The harmonious blue and white collection is an ode to Tove Jansson’s life and work. The design is inspired by the soft, tactile forms of the rocky island of Klovharun, where Tove spent her summers. The illustrations are inspired by wreaths designed by the artist herself.

Too-Ticky

Too-Ticky

Too-Ticky is a wise and helpful friend of the Moomins. Unlike most of the inhabitants of Moominvalley, she doesn’t hibernate. Too-Ticky is skilled at solving problems, and she is quite perky by nature. Too-Ticky spends her winters in the Moomin bath house, with invisible shrews to keep her company! Too-Ticky believes that everyone learns through their experiences and mistakes. She likes repairing things. Too-Ticky wears a striped shirt, dark trousers and a cap with a tussle. She first appeared in Tove Jansson’s novel Moominland Midwinter.
